1
by Wootton, Richard (Ed.)
Published 2009
“...IDRC (International Development Research Centre)...”Published 2009
Book
2
by Alampay, Erwin (Ed.)
Published 2009
“...IDRC (International Development Research Centre)...”Published 2009
Book
3